Pro Designer Notes for Holiday Production

Before adding Hibiscus to your seasonal embroidery file library, do these five things:

  1. Check stitch density: Photo stitch designs often pack dense fills—verify your machine handles it smoothly on medium-weight fabric before bulk production.
  2. Confirm hoop size & format compatibility: Since this is a larger photo stitch design, cross-check your embroidery machine’s max hoop dimensions and supported file types against Creative Fabrica’s specs.
  3. Test thread colors on both light and dark fabric: Vintage palettes shift dramatically—what reads as warm coral on ivory may mute to dusty rose on charcoal.
  4. Create realistic mockups: Use actual fabric swatches—not just digital previews—to assess how Hibiscus interacts with texture, drape, and lighting (especially important for holiday product photography).
  5. Review licensing details carefully: As a Single Flowers embroidery design intended for commercial embroidery, confirm Creative Fabrica’s terms allow finished product resale—especially for holiday-edition bundles or limited-time apparel drops.
